Restaurants have been a part of Pete’s life since the age of 19. He has opened seven in his time as a chef and restaurateur. High-profile catering is another proud passion – from a royal banquet for the Prince and Princess of Denmark to a private dinner for Martha Stewart or a gala G’Day USA dinner for 600 in New York City, Pete loves making any event super special. Cooking, food and lifestyle TV programs have been another of Pete’s highly successful pursuits. Starting out in 2001 as a co-presenter on the Lifestyle Channel’s Home show, his credits also include Postcards from Home, FISH, and co-host with Manu Feildel since 2009 of Channel 7’s hugely and internationally successful My Kitchen Rules. Pete’s latest TV series, Moveable Feast, showcases America’s finest artisans, producers and chefs and is currently screening in the US. Supporting organisations in synch with his own values is another of Pete’s passions. He is involved with Regenesis Youth (a new organisation dedicated to empowering disengaged teenagers) and the Mindd Foundation (using integrative healthcare, including food as medicine, in the treatment of metabolic, immunologic, neurologic, digestive and developmental conditions that often affect the mind). Pete is also an ambassador of the Australian Organic Schools garden project.
